The WR time is set in GM mode as follow : 1/ At startup the NTP time is set using wr_date script 2/ PPSi calls the tool wr_date with parameters "set host". It will be called every time it detects a PLL transition from UNLOCKED to LOCKED state. Also PPSi provide a error counter 'gmUnlockErr' which gives the number of time the PLL unlocked. 3/ Parameters "-v set host" in wr_date tool, set only the second part of the WR time. The time is set in a middle of two WR seconds ticks.
